Here is another card for our Shopping your Stash challenge. 

There's Gnome one like you - a card featuring at least one Gnome.


The only Gnome stamps I have are Christmas stamps so Christmas card it is. This is a PolkaDoodles stamp and to my shame, I have never used it before. I'm more of an inky effects card maker. 


This is nothing like what I planned when I chose kraft card but heyho! I think I'd imagined pale snowy colours but instead I give you red and green. 
The lamp is a separate stamp so I cut out a partial mask to stamp it behind the carol singers. 

After I'd mounted it on a piece of very old card stock, so old I don't even know where it came from, I went in with a white pen and added a leafy border. Thus proving why I use stamps and don't draw my own cards. 😁
